Block 137,959
Block Hash
69cab91eb068dddb324a37b6d0232fa702df3f6e36a52fda4c40e312df
debc2a
Previous Block Hash
eecfda240f30b19b3505afd0a400ec743132bba4efca763d8dd7688838 3752c8
Mined
Transactions
1
Difficulty
2.22 M
Size
182 bytes
Transactions (1)
1 input, 1 output
250,000.00
PEPE